Output 364cb370f64ed40de701dd571c24f97ef0f59f2e7f5a1c270881a70b908458fd:15

value
99625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de1a89d43dec9c2be84769a04542214bc5121a73 OP_EQUAL
address
3MwPj3roZTQvVt5D8FuEkVy5h7bSq1X73a
transaction
364cb370f64ed40de701dd571c24f97ef0f59f2e7f5a1c270881a70b908458fd
spent
true